HD - Recording 3 Press MENU + or - on the remote repeatedly until "Setup?" flashes in the display, then press ENTER/YES on the remote. 4 Press MENU + or - on the remote repeatedly until "S.Space On" (or "S.Space Off") appears in the display, then press ENTER/YES on the remote. 5 Press MENU + or - on the remote to select the setting, then press ENTER/ YES on the remote. To Select Turn on the Smart Space and Auto Cut functions S.Space On. (factory setting) Turn off the Smart Space and Auto Cut functions S.Space Off. 6 Press MENU/NO on the remote. Notes • When you record from a CD, Smart Space does not affect the order of the track numbers being recorded, even if the blank space occurs in the middle of a track. • Auto Cut is automatically turned on or off in tandem with Smart Space. • If the system continues recording pause for about 10 minutes after Auto Cut activated, recording stops automatically. • If this function is activated when the 400th track is reached, recording stops. • During Auto Storage or High-Speed Synchro Storage, the Smart Space and Auto Cut functions do not function. Adjusting the recording level You can adjust the recording level for both analog and digital recordings. 1 Do steps 1 and 2 of "Recording to the HD manually" on page 26. 2 Play the portion of the sound source with the strongest output. 3 Press MENU/NO on the remote. "Setup?" appears in the display. 4 Press ENTER/YES on the remote. "Setup Menu" appears in the display. 5 Press MENU + or - on the remote repeatedly until "LevelAdjust?" appears in the display, then press ENTER/YES on the remote. 6 Press MENU + or - on the remote repeatedly to adjust the recording level so that the OVER indicator on the peak level meters does not turn on. 7 Press ENTER/YES on the remote. 8 Press MENU/NO on the remote. 9 Stop playing the sound source. 10 Do step 3 of "Recording to the HD manually" on page 26. Tip To restore the factory setting, press CLEAR on the remote while adjusting the recording level in step 6. Notes • The recording level can only be increased up to +12 dB (for analog recording) or +18 dB (for digital recording) (0.0 dB is the factory setting). Therefore, if the output level of the connected components is low, it may not be possible to set the recording level to maximum. • The monitor sound is not affected when you adjust the recording level during recording. • During Auto Storage or High-Speed Synchro Storage, CD tracks are recorded at the same level as the original tracks. The adjusted recording level is not applied during Auto Storage or High-Speed Synchro Storage. 29GB
